In this episode of the Sped Prep Academy Podcast, we had the pleasure of hosting Melysa Mei, a passionate preschool teacher from NYC.

Melysa has been teaching for 17 years and is a devoted play advocate. To help spread the play-based love Melysa started her own online business - Pre-K Spot helping other early educators in child-led play-based strategies. With experience ranging from nannying, to early intervention, to classroom teacher she uses her experience and knowledge to support not only her students but fellow early educators as well.

Melysa shares her expertise in creating inclusive, play-based learning experiences for young learners.

Listen in as we discuss:

  • benefits of play-based learning, emphasizing how it fosters social interactions, multisensory experiences, and natural engagement
  • best classroom practices, including how to incorporates students' interests and strengths into activities
  • the importance of collaboration with families and professionals and shared strategies for differentiation to meet diverse student needs.
  • the challenges in implementing play-based and inclusive practices and how to overcome those challenges
